Bessemer Group Inc. Sells 16,345 Shares of WEC Energy Group, Inc. (NYSE:WEC)

WEC Energy Group logo with Utilities background

Bessemer Group Inc. decreased its stake in WEC Energy Group, Inc. (NYSE:WEC - Free Report) by 1.8% in the 1st qu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The firm owned 915,387 shares of the utilities provider's stock after selling 16,345 shares during the period. Bessemer Group Inc. owned 0.29% of WEC Energy Group worth $99,760,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

WEC Energy Group (NYSE:WEC -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, May 6th. The utilities provider reported $2.27 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$2.18 by $0.09. The business had revenue of $3.15 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$2.81 billion. WEC Energy Group had a return on equity of 12.94% and a net margin of 17.95%. The business's revenue was up 17.5%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ter last year, the business posted $1.97 EPS. As a group, equities research analysts expect that WEC Energy Group, Inc. will post 5.23 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

WEC Energy Group Increases Dividend

The company also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Sunday, June 1st. Stockholders of record on Wednesday, May 14th were paid a $0.8975 dividend. This represents a $3.59 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 3.48%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Wednesday, May 14th. This is a boost from WEC Energy Group's previous quarterly dividend of $0.84. WEC Energy Group's dividend payout ratio (DPR) is presently 69.59%.

WEC Energy Group Profile

(Free Report)

WEC Energy Group, Inc, through its subsidiaries, provides regulated natural gas and electricity, and renewable and nonregulated renewable energy services in the United States. It operates through Wisconsin, Illinois, Other States, Electric Transmission, and Non-Utility Energy Infrastructure segments.
